Mouth/vent exit size is so small ? I had to cut mine open here in a paraflex version that ‘chuffed’. I dunno drawings are deceiving
That's why I provided the Particle Velocity screen in my post. 412.9cm2 is almost half of the 855cm2 Sd.
412.90cm2 = 16" x 4".
619.35cm2 = 16" x 6".
825.80cm2 = 16" x 8"...855cm2 = B&C 15PZB40 Sd.
1651.61cm2 = 16" x 16".
